Sensitivity Led; Jewel Indicator; Bypass Footswitch; Slow/Fast Footswitch - Fender Bubbler Chorus User Manual

Sensitivity LED

This LED will illuminate when your instrument's signal passes the
threshold set with the Sensitivity control to ramp the Bubbler's chorusing
speed from the Slow settings to the Fast settings.

Jewel Indicator

The Jewel Indicator shows when the chorus effect is active.

Bypass Footswitch

This footswitch is used to bypass the effect.

Slow/Fast Footswitch

This footswitch is used to toggle between the Slow and Fast chorus
speeds. The Slow controls are Rate 1 and Depth 1; the Fast controls
are Rate 2 and Depth 2.
Input Jack
This is a high-impedance input suitable for electric guitar, bass, acoustic
guitars with pickup systems, keyboards and other instruments.
Left/Mono Output Jack
This is a low-impedance output jack that connects to the amp or to the
next effect pedal in a mono signal chain.
Right Output Jack
This is a low-impedance output jack that connects to the amp or to the
next effect pedal in a stereo signal chain.
DC Power Connector
This is a standard center-negative 9VDC jack for use with appropriate
power supplies.
LED Kill Switch
This switch extinguishes the LEDs that illuminate the knobs.
